Saffron Rice Pilaf

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:25 mins
Total Time:35 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ups basmati rice
  • 2 cups water
  • 1 cup chicken or vegetable broth
  • 0.5 teaspoons saffron threads
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 0.5 yellow on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.25 cup slivered almonds (optional, toasted)
  • 0.25 cup dried currants or raisins (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Directions

Step 1

Rinse the basmati rice in cold water until the water runs clear to remove excess starch. Drain and set aside.

Step 2

In a small b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of warm water and the saffron threads. Allow the saffron to bloom for 5 minutes.

Step 3

Heat the butter and olive oil in a large saucepan or deep skillet over medium heat.

Step 4

Add the finely chopped yellow onion and cook, stirring frequently, until soft and translucent, about 3-4 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ional 1 minute, until fragrant.

Step 5

Stir in the rinsed basmati rice and cook for 2-3 minutes, coating the grains in the butter and oil mixture.

Step 6

Add the saffron water, chicken or vegetable broth, water, bay leaf, cinnamon stick, and salt to the saucepan. Stir to combine.

Step 7

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 15-17 minutes, or until the rice is tender and the liquid is fully absorbed.

Step 8

Remove the saucepan from heat and let it sit, covered, for 5 minutes to allow the rice to steam.

Step 9

Remove the bay leaf and cinnamon stick. Fluff the rice gently with a fork.

Step 10

If desired, fold in the toasted slivered almonds and dried currants or raisins for added texture and flavor.

Step 11

Transfer the saffron rice pilaf to a serving dish and garnish with chopped fresh parsley before serving.
